April 20, 2023 .Ruth Margalit studied English Literature and History at Tel Aviv University and earned a master’s degree in journalism from Columbia University. She is a contributing writer to magazines and newspapers including The New York Times Magazine, The New Yorker, The New York Review of Books, Columbia Journalism Review, Harper’s, Haaretz, Tablet . Margalit (Hebrew: מרגלית, lit. pearl ) is a Hebrew -language given name and surname. Before the First Aliyah it was mainly used in this form by Sephardic Jews , [1] [2] while its variant Margulis was more common among Ashkenazis.Avishai Margalit (Hebrew: אבישי מרגלית, born 1939) is an Israeli professor emeritus in philosophy at the Hebrew University of Jerusalem. From 2006 to 2011, he served as the George F. Kennan Professor at the Institute for Advanced Study in Princeton .
